Definition of «biggest hurdle»

The phrase "biggest hurdle" refers to an obstacle or challenge that is considered to be the most difficult, significant and daunting out of all other challenges. It's something that stands in the way of achieving a goal or completing a task, and requires extra effort, resources, creativity or determination to overcome it. The term can also refer to an obstacle that is particularly hard to surmount due to its nature, complexity or magnitude. In essence, "biggest hurdle" represents the most significant barrier standing between someone and their desired outcome.
